Ignore:
Timestamp:
2020-08-29T13:33:25+02:00 (4 years ago)
Author:
simon04
Message:

see #8334 - Add advanced option to scale the table font

Advanced preference keys gui.scale.table.*

Location:
trunk/src/org/openstreetmap/josm/gui/dialogs
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/openstreetmap/josm/gui/dialogs/LayerListDialog.java

    r16828 r16960  
    210210        //
    211211        layerList = new LayerList(model);
     212        TableHelper.setFont(layerList, getClass());
    212213        layerList.setSelectionModel(selectionModel);
    213214        layerList.addMouseListener(new PopupMenuHandler());
     
    919920            Icon icon = layer.getIcon();
    920921            if (layerList != null && icon != null) {
    921                 layerList.setRowHeight(idx, Math.max(16, icon.getIconHeight()));
     922                layerList.setRowHeight(idx, Math.max(layerList.getRowHeight(), icon.getIconHeight()));
    922923            }
    923924            selectionModel.setSelectionInterval(idx, idx);
  • trunk/src/org/openstreetmap/josm/gui/dialogs/properties/PropertiesDialog.java

    r16598 r16960  
    315315    private void buildTagsTable() {
    316316        // setting up the tags table
     317        TableHelper.setFont(tagTable, getClass());
    317318        tagData.setColumnIdentifiers(new String[]{tr("Key"), tr("Value")});
    318319        tagTable.setSelectionMode(ListSelectionModel.MULTIPLE_INTERVAL_SELECTION);
     
    339340
    340341    private void buildMembershipTable() {
     342        TableHelper.setFont(membershipTable, getClass());
    341343        membershipData.setColumnIdentifiers(new String[]{tr("Member Of"), tr("Role"), tr("Position")});
    342344        membershipTable.setSelectionMode(ListSelectionModel.MULTIPLE_INTERVAL_SELECTION);
  • trunk/src/org/openstreetmap/josm/gui/dialogs/relation/SelectionTable.java

    r15048 r16960  
    99import javax.swing.ListSelectionModel;
    1010import javax.swing.SwingUtilities;
     11
     12import org.openstreetmap.josm.gui.util.TableHelper;
    1113
    1214/**
     
    3234
    3335    protected void build() {
     36        TableHelper.setFont(this, getClass());
    3437        setSelectionMode(ListSelectionModel.SINGLE_SELECTION);
    3538        addMouseListener(new DoubleClickAdapter());
Note: See TracChangeset for help on using the changeset viewer.